Health Technician

Job Description

The Health Technician position is in the outlying Community Based Outpatient Clinics (CBOC's) and is aligned under Nursing Service. The positions will be located at the Golden, and Aurora clinics. This position will provide clinical support for patients who require Laboratory testing to contribute to overall clinic functionality.

Qualifications

To qualify for this position, applicants must meet all requirements by the closing date of this announcement. GS-5 Specialized Experience: One year of specialized experience equivalent to at least the GS-04 grade level in Federal service that has required application of the knowledge, methods, and techniques of this position. Examples of qualifying specialized experience include: Knowledge of collection requirements such as tube order, proper fill amounts, and collection temperature and storage requirements; Knowledge of guidelines related to Phlebotomy Procedures; Skill in venipuncture is necessary to obtain required quantities of specimens needed for a large battery of tests requested with the subsequent labeling, preservation, special handling of select specimens, storage, as well as correct patient identification prior to drawing; required knowledge of computer procedures sufficient to perform work in numerous lab and radiology menu selections. OR Education: Successful completion of a full 4-year course of study leading to a bachelor's degree with major study or at least 24 semester hours in subjects directly related to the position. This education must have been obtained in an accredited business or technical school, junior college, college, or university for which high school graduation or the equivalent is the normal prerequisite. One year of full-time undergraduate study is defined as 30 semester hours, 45 quarter hours, or the equivalent in a college or university or at least 20 hours of classroom instruction per week for approximately 36 weeks in a business or technical school. Transcripts required. OR Combination: An equivalent combination of specialized experience and education as described that demonstrates your ability to perform the duties of this position. Transcripts required, and experience must be detailed in your resume to receive credit.
